Luigi Caputo

March 10, 1934 — May 8, 2018

Luigi Caputo

84, of Johnston, passed away at his home on Tuesday, May 8, 2018. He was the loving husband of Maria (Coletta) Caputo. They were to celebrate their 60th wedding anniversary. Born in Pulsano, Taranto in Italy, he was a son of the late Pietro and Maria Graziella (D’Amato) Caputo. Mr. Caputo was employed by American Hoechst for twenty-five years, along with his own painting business that he worked on the side. Luigi spent the past twenty-nine years during the winters in Port Charlotte, FL. He enjoyed playing bocce, wine making, gardening, but mostly being with his loving family and close friends.

Besides his wife, Luigi is survived by his four loving children, Aldo Caputo and his wife Carla of Greenville, Gino Caputo and his wife Cindy of Johnston, Roberto Caputo and his fiancée Lori of Cranston and Rosamaria Gallucci and her husband Joseph of Cranston. Luigi was the cherished grandfather of Michael and Vincent Caputo, Maria and Joanna Gallucci and Robert L. Caputo. He was the brother of Ziata Screti of Taranto, Italy, Dolores Alfieri of Port Charlotte, FL and the late Cosimo Caputi.
